Hello, everyone, Adam Theo here. I would like to announce a pre-release of the latest SMTP Transport. It is currently just in JabberStudio CVS, but within the next week will be tarballed into version 1.10.
It is entirely written in Perl5 and requires a number of Perl modules. It does not need superuser access, but can drop down to a normal user anyway. It uses INET sockets. It can receive MIME email attachments and save them locally, passing HTTP links to them in the Jabber messages.
